Web29 jul. 2024 · If you notice a snow-like accumulation closer to the front of the unit, the problem is likely that the freezer isn’t quite cold enough. This could be because cool air is escaping through a gap in the door. Confirm that nothing inside the freezer is preventing the door from closing all the way.

WebEven if the gasket's perfect, if the freezer doesn't have a thaw cycle you'll probably get some frost anyway. Gaskets aren't completely cheap compared to buying a new unit so you may want to do the math on what makes the most sense for long-term. Realistically, I think you can expect frost on any freezer/fridge combo as there won't be a thaw cycle. WebIce can form on the bottom of freezers for a few reasons. The most common are humid air entering the freezer, faulty door seals and poor ventilation. To prevent ice from building up, try the solutions below to resolve your issue.
